Retina ; 9(4): 302-11, 1989.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-2697919

RESUMO

We report two cases of combined hamartoma of the sensory retina and retinal pigment epithelium (CHR-RPE) in which apparent growth of the lesion was observed. In case 1, the eye was enucleated with a presumed diagnosis of juxtapapillary malignant melanoma. Histopathologically, the enucleated globe showed an elevated peripapillary mass containing disorganized retinal tissue intermixed with vascular and glial elements as well as tubules of proliferating retinal pigment epithelium. We have summarized the clinical features of 53 patients with CHR-RPE reported between 1952 and 1988 excluding the cases compiled by the Macular Society Collaborative Study. While the latter study found an equal sex predilection among their cases, we found a 70% male preponderance among the 53 patients. Of the 54 lesions observed in 53 patients, 76% were juxtapapillary, 17% were macular, and 7% were peripheral. Furthermore, periodic follow-up examination disclosed apparent enlargement of the mass in six patients, five of whom underwent enucleation of the globe for suspected melanoma.

Ophthalmologica ; 194(1): 19-26, 1987.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-2438619

RESUMO

Sixty eyes in 58 patients with either juxtafoveal or parafoveal neovascular membranes were treated with monochromatic green argon photocoagulation. The visual acuity was stabilized or improved in 73.2% (22 eyes) in both the juxtafoveal and parafoveal groups. Total eradication of the neovascular membranes was possible in 86.6% (26 eyes) in the juxtafoveal group and 93.4% (28 eyes) of the parafoveal group. This study suggests that successful treatment of both juxtafoveal and parafoveal neovascular membranes can be accomplished with monochromatic green argon photocoagulation.

Graefes Arch Clin Exp Ophthalmol ; 224(3): 205-14, 1986.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-3519367

RESUMO

Spindle cells in the hyperoxygenated, avascular, vanguard retina are proposed to be the peripheral inducers of the neovascularization associated with retinopathy of prematurity (ROP). The induction of ROP is conceptualized in terms of three basic events. First, activation of spindle cells results initially in the increase in gap junctions between adjacent spindle cells, secondarily in the increase in cytoplasmic volume of rough endoplasmic reticulum, and ultimately in the synthesis and secretion of angiogenic factors Second, maturation of spindle cells is associated with a decrease in gap junctions, a diminished cytoplasmic volume of rough endoplasmic reticulum, and a cessation of synthesis and secretion of angiogenic factors. Third, myofibroblasts invade the vitreous concomitantly with spindle cell maturation and provide the tractional force that can produce retinal separation. The extent of interstitial retinol binding protein within the subretinal space explains the gestational-age-dependent efficacy of vitamin E in suppressing the development of severe ROP. The kinetics of both spindle cell activation/maturation and myofibroblast invasion predict the efficacy of appropriately timed and placed transretinal cryotherapy.

Ann Ophthalmol ; 17(2): 114-25, 1985 Feb.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-3994210

RESUMO

A method of treatment for posteriorly located malignant melanomas of the choroid is reviewed. Twenty-six patients have been treated either by radioactive gold (198Au) seed radiation plaque, alone or in combination with postradiation xenon-arc photocoagulation. Success, defined as the preservation of the globe with tumor ablated or regressed, was achieved in 92.3% of the treated eyes. These patients have been followed from 1 to 8.5 years, with an average follow-up of 44.84 months. Fifteen out of 26 patients (57.69%) had a final visual acuity of 20/50 or better. The main complications were radiation retinopathy (19.2%) and cystoid macular edema (19.2%). There were two enucleations, one after 29 months and one after 24 months following treatment.

Ophthalmology ; 92(2): 297-302, 1985 Feb.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-3982808

RESUMO

Pigmented free-floating vitreous cysts were observed in two young adults. In both patients, the cyst was in the visual axis; however, the size and extent of pigmentation of the cyst wall compromised the visual acuity only in case 1. In this case, the vitreous cyst was aspirated through the pars plana and studied by light and electron microscopy. Histopathologically, the cyst was lined by a heavily pigmented layer of cuboidal cells intermixed with sheets of nonpigmented cells forming papillae. Ultrastructurally, the pigmented cells contained predominantly large, mature melanosomes (0.9-2.2 micron). Scattered immature melanosomes with a scarcity of mitochondria and other cytoplasmic organelles were present. Additionally, the cells were invested by a thin polarized basement membrane and displayed apical microvilli. Numerous microvillous processes were noted under the plasmalemmae and between adjacent cells. The results of the light and ultrastructural studies provide support for the hypothesis that the cyst in case 1 originated from the pigment epithelium. The possibility of a traumatic etiology is proposed for these pigmented vitreous cysts. If significant visual impairment is present, surgical removal of the cyst through a pars plana approach can be safely performed as in our case 1.

Ann Ophthalmol ; 15(11): 1084-6, 1983 Nov.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-6651146

RESUMO

Adverse reactions were noted in 241 (4.82%) of 5,000 consecutive intravenous fluorescein angiographies of the retina. The most frequent adverse reactions were nausea (2.24%), vomiting (1.78%), and urticaria/pruritus (0.34%). No life-threatening reactions were noted. No significant difference in the rate of adverse reactions was found when angiography using 10% fluorescein was compared with angiography using 25% fluorescein.

Am J Ophthalmol ; 95(5): 593-7, 1983 May.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-6846452

RESUMO

When we compared the incidence of retinal detachment in 27 eyes after extracapsular cataract surgery and late posterior capsulotomy with the incidence of general aphakic detachment, we found no relationship between the onset of retinal detachment and the numbers, types, or locations of breaks. The interval between cataract extraction and discission had a significant effect on recovery of visual acuity. Final visual acuities of 20/400 or better were attained in 22 of 23 eyes in which discission followed cataract extraction by one year or more but in only one of four eyes in which the procedures were separated by less than one year. Delaying discission for more than 12 months may reduce the extent of retinal detachment and produce the best functional results. Detachments that occurred less than one year after discission were more extensive but achieved better functional results than those that occurred later.

Ophthalmology ; 89(10): 1160-9, 1982 Oct.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-6897562

RESUMO

Experience with scleral buckling for exudative and tractional retinal detachments in very young premature infants who have acute retrolental fibroplasia (RLF) is reported. In this series, surgery was successful in 24 of 32 eyes (75%) of 23 infants, (age at surgery ranged from 1.75 months to 6 months, average age of 3 months). We attribute the 15% improvement in the success rate over our 1979 series in part to closer screening with emphasis on the examination at age 8 weeks, to earlier referral for treatment, and to our observation that these fragile eyes can withstand reoperation if buckle revision is necessary to combat persistent retinal traction. We encountered no serious complications either at surgery or immediately after surgery. We stress that (1) because of the high incidence of spontaneous remission, buckling surgery should not be performed until the detachment has progressed well posterior to the equator and remission is obviously unlikely (Grade IV or V); (2) excessive cryotherapy and undue surgical trauma should be avoided; and (3) because scleral erosion is certain as the eyes grow, the encircling band should be transected six months to one year after surgery.

Ann Ophthalmol ; 14(7): 639-45, 1982 Jul.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-7125454

RESUMO

The records for a group of 2,054 patients who had undergone surgery fur rhegmatogenous retinal detachment with macular involvement were analyzed to ascertain the relative influence of the following five specific factors on postoperative visual acuity: (1) patient age, (2) degree of preoperative macular elevation, (3) duration of preoperative macular detachment, (4) extent of retinal detachment, and (5) drainage of subretinal fluid. Increasing patient age, increasing preoperative macular elevation, increasing duration of macular detachment, and increasing extent of retinal detachment were all found to be associated in general with decreasing postoperative visual acuity. Drainage, or nondrainage, or subretinal fluid appeared to be unassociated with postoperative visual acuity.

Ann Ophthalmol ; 14(3): 268-70, 1982 Mar.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-7092037

RESUMO

The causes of 653 cases of spontaneous vitreous hemorrhage were evaluated. The four most common causes, accounting for over 84% of the cases, were diabetic retinopathy (34.1%), retinal break without retinal detachment (22.4%), rhegmatogenous retinal detachment (14.9%), and retinal vein occlusion (13.0%). Other diagnoses accounting for a significant number of cases of spontaneous vitreous hemorrhage included posterior vitreous detachment, retinal vasculitis, senescent macular degeneration, intraocular tumor, and retinopathy of prematurity. The remaining, uncommon, diagnoses accounted for less than 5% of the cases.

Ophthalmology ; 86(5): 803-16, 1979 May.
Artigo em Inglês | MEDLINE | ID: mdl-583499

RESUMO

Abnormalities that occur in the anterior segments of patients with retinopathy of prematurity have been studied in 72 eyes of 36 patients. The anterior chamber depth, the placido disc image on the cornea, the distortion of polarized light by corneal stress, and keratometry readings were recorded. There was a highly significant correlation between anterior chamber depth, retinopathy of prematurity, and keratometry readings (p less than .001). These findings emphasize the importance of careful follow-up examinations of the anterior segment in retinopathy of prematurity because cataracts, band keratopathy, acute hydrops, and angle-closure glaucoma can progressively occur as complications.
